Resynchroniser les séquences PostgreSQL après tout import/restore de dump Si la prod (ou tout environnement) est **montée depuis un dump** (`pg_restore` / `COPY`), les lignes sont chargées avec leurs `id` explicites **sans avancer les séquences** → au premier `INSERT` : `duplicate key value violates unique constraint "..._pkey"` (constaté en local sur `notification`, `task`, `time_entry`…). À lancer **juste après chaque restore/import** : ```sql DO $$ DECLARE r RECORD; maxid BIGINT; seq TEXT; BEGIN FOR r IN SELECT table_name, column_name FROM information_schema.columns WHERE table_schema='public' LOOP seq := pg_get_serial_sequence(quote_ident(r.table_name), r.column_name); IF seq IS NOT NULL THEN EXECUTE format('SELECT COALESCE(MAX(%I),0) FROM %I', r.column_name, r.table_name) INTO maxid; PERFORM setval(seq, GREATEST(maxid,1), maxid > 0); END IF; END LOOP; END $$; ``` > Ne concerne **pas** une prod qui tourne déjà (séquences avancées organiquement) — uniquement le cas restore/import. Idempotent, sans risque. ### 2. Fix dénormalisation des collections typées-contrat (code, inclus dans la branche) Les relations **to-many** typées par une interface `Shared\Domain\Contract\*` (`TimeEntry::tags` → `TaskTagInterface`, `Task::collaborators` → `UserInterface`) étaient **indénormalisables par API Platform** (mono-valué OK via IRI, collection KO) → **tout POST/PATCH portant une telle collection renvoyait 400/500**. Corrigé par un dénormaliseur générique `ContractRelationDenormalizer` (réutilise `resolve_target_entities`, zéro couplage par-entité) + test fonctionnel de non-régression. --------- Co-authored-by: Matthieu <contact@malio.fr> Reviewed-on: #17
